]> cloud.milkyroute.net Git - dolphin.git/commitdiff
Changed default arg for the setSplitViewEnabled
authorarnav dhamija <arnav.dhamija@gmail.com>
Wed, 2 Nov 2016 16:19:11 +0000 (21:49 +0530)
committerarnav dhamija <arnav.dhamija@gmail.com>
Wed, 2 Nov 2016 16:19:11 +0000 (21:49 +0530)
src/dolphinmainwindow.cpp
src/dolphintabpage.cpp
src/dolphintabpage.h

index 687b306987dee06277dd37c897acf0c05c613b16..9817bf08a592428382fce75b1465483de72f6aa2 100644 (file)
@@ -527,7 +527,7 @@ void DolphinMainWindow::toggleSplitView()
 void DolphinMainWindow::toggleSplitStash()
 {
     DolphinTabPage* tabPage = m_tabWidget->currentTabPage();
-    tabPage->setSplitViewEnabled(!tabPage->splitViewEnabled(), true);
+    tabPage->setSplitViewEnabled(!tabPage->splitViewEnabled(), QUrl("stash:/"));
 }
 
 void DolphinMainWindow::reloadView()
index 3491dbad8b7cb132adac295fc902ee76ec05ed17..9d239fdfc690894a6dcc5f54ccff0528c5ef2455 100644 (file)
@@ -71,13 +71,13 @@ bool DolphinTabPage::splitViewEnabled() const
     return m_splitViewEnabled;
 }
 
-void DolphinTabPage::setSplitViewEnabled(bool enabled, bool stash /*= false*/)
+void DolphinTabPage::setSplitViewEnabled(bool enabled, QUrl secondaryUrl /*= QUrl()*/)
 {
     if (m_splitViewEnabled != enabled) {
         m_splitViewEnabled = enabled;
 
         if (enabled) {
-            const QUrl& url = (stash) ? QUrl("stash:/") : m_primaryViewContainer->url();
+            const QUrl& url = (secondaryUrl.isEmpty()) ? m_primaryViewContainer->url() : secondaryUrl;
             m_secondaryViewContainer = createViewContainer(url);
 
             const bool placesSelectorVisible = m_primaryViewContainer->urlNavigator()->isPlacesSelectorVisible();
index d145745614d7acad000d54d6be736f43ea6084e0..023f216fc3bc73942548d9852cedd84fd7412629 100644 (file)
@@ -50,7 +50,7 @@ public:
      *
      * If \a enabled is true, it creates a secondary view with the url of the primary view.
      */
-    void setSplitViewEnabled(bool enabled, bool stash = false);
+    void setSplitViewEnabled(bool enabled, QUrl secondaryUrl = QUrl());
 
     /**
      * @return The primary view containter.